Lyon attacker Marick Faufana has linked his moves from French clubs over the past few months, with Chelsea and Liverpool keen on him during the summer transfers.

The players are attracting interest from two Premier League clubs. However, he made it clear that interest from the two clubs was not specific. It will be interesting to see if they will come forward with offers to sign a younger attacker in the future.

The Belgians were incredible talent with a bright future and were able to develop into world-class players with the right guidance. Chelsea and Liverpool needed more quality on the sides and they were able to develop him into a future star.

Tottenham is also enthusiastic about Fofana.

Forwarding link fofana

“I was interested in these two clubs, but in the end I wasn’t particularly specific enough.” Fofana told HBVL. “I thought about transfers, but I think it’s more important now that I play a lot, and that has to happen in Lyon, because there’s still progress.

“Of course (I want to go to the 2026 World Cup) I still realize there’s still a lot to prove. I’ve already made progress. I’m now more critical and involved in the game.

“I’m just a normal young man and I’m staying cool. I’m not focused on the media either. I’m doing what I want to do: dribbling and score.”
